The Game is really great but i've a few suggestions :-Alderian News!
Hello everyone,
First things first, after failing and now correcting (hopefully) a few things on the Steam page, we've pushed through for a second review of the page, as soon as we pass, we'll make a public annoucement along with the release of the launch trailer.
With the saves issue now temporarily resolved, all of attention on the coding front is being focused towards improving combat and the RPG experience, which thankfully, is begining to take shape and is so far going well.
As you can see from the above, the attributes and stats have been completely overhauled into something more robust and useful, right now as of testing for exaple, enemies and players can now dodge attacks.
We're still in the midst of active changes, and we'll be showing you guys more as we go soon!
You may notice additional non-combat RPG stats such 'intimidation,' which will open up some less than friendly options when dealing with various NPCs rather than just relying on your silver-tongued approach.
Additional systems are being intergrated, including one which can have some *unusual* effects on gameplay depending on what you pick...
Finally, on the art front, I'd like to introduce the final (for now) Mage of Palam you'll get to meet soon, Mika!
Mika ... A tomboy country girl far more suited to tending fields than being a mage, she isn't the smartest around but she darn tries her best!
